Madhya Pradesh · Assembly Constituency 42 · 2003
Deori
Winner — 2003
RATAN SINGH SILARPUR
BJP· BJP (NDA)
BJP 36.9%INC 26.7%6 others 36.4%
Votes
40,930
37.0% share
Winning margin
11,371
10.3% of votes
Total candidates
8
Turnout
70.3%
of 1,57,674
A clear win with a 10.3% margin.
Seat history
All Candidates
8 total| # |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| RATAN SINGH SILARPUR | BJP (NDA) | 40,930 | 37.0% |
| 2 | HARSH YADAV | INC | 29,559 | 26.7% |
| 3 | SUNIL JAIN | IND | 21,084 | 19.0% |
| 4 | KUNWAR AWADH RAJ SINGH MARSHKOLE | IND | 14,398 | 13.0% |
| 5 | MOHAN SINGH RAJPUT | 1,631 | 1.5% | |
| 6 | RAMAN CHATURVEDI | IND | 1,495 | 1.4% |
| 7 | NANHE BHAI | IND | 971 | 0.9% |
| 8 | PRADEEP JOSHI | IND | 707 | 0.6% |
